Understanding E-Bike Shipping Regulations and Battery Safety
Before you even think about boxing up your electric bike, the most critical step is understanding the rules, especially concerning its battery. Lithium-ion batteries are classified as dangerous goods by transportation authorities due to their potential fire risk if mishandled or damaged. This isn’t just a suggestion; it’s a non-negotiable safety standard.
Why E-Bike Batteries Are a Big Deal for Shippers
Most carriers have strict guidelines for shipping lithium-ion batteries. The capacity of your e-bike’s battery (measured in Watt-hours, or Wh) dictates how it can be shipped. Generally, batteries over 100Wh and up to 300Wh can often be shipped with specific precautions, while those exceeding 300Wh are much harder, sometimes impossible, for standard air cargo.
Always check your battery’s Wh rating. This information is usually printed directly on the battery pack. If you can’t find it, calculate it by multiplying the voltage (V) by the amp-hours (Ah) – for example, a 48V 10Ah battery is 480Wh.
Carrier-Specific Battery Rules
Different carriers (UPS, FedEx, USPS, specialty freight) have varying rules. Some may require the battery to be shipped separately, others may allow it to be installed but disconnected, and some may refuse large batteries altogether.
Always contact your chosen carrier directly and explicitly state you are shipping an electric bike with a lithium-ion battery. Ask about their specific requirements for packaging, labeling, and documentation. This upfront research can save you significant delays and costs.
Choosing the Right Shipping Carrier for Your Electric Bike
Selecting the right carrier is paramount. Not all services are equipped or willing to handle e-bikes, especially with their batteries. Your choice will depend on your budget, timeline, and the specific needs of your electric bicycle.
Standard Parcel Carriers (UPS, FedEx)
These are often the first thought for shipping, and they can work for e-bikes. However, they have weight and dimension limits. An e-bike usually requires a large, sturdy box, which can incur oversized package surcharges.
Battery restrictions are very strict. UPS and FedEx generally require the battery to be removed and shipped separately as a Class 9 hazardous material, which means special packaging, labeling, and documentation. This can significantly increase complexity and cost.
Specialty Bike Shippers
Several companies specialize in shipping bicycles, including electric models. Services like BikeFlights, ShipBikes, or local bike shops often partner with freight carriers. They understand the nuances of bike packaging and battery regulations.
These services might offer pre-paid labels, specific bike boxes, and even insurance tailored for bicycles. While potentially more expensive than standard ground shipping, they often simplify the process and reduce the risk of damage or regulatory issues.
Freight Forwarders
For very large or heavy e-bikes, or if you’re shipping internationally, a freight forwarder might be necessary. They handle bulk cargo and can manage complex customs declarations and hazardous material shipments.
This option is typically more expensive and involves more paperwork, but it’s often the only viable solution for specific scenarios, especially with high-capacity batteries that can’t go via air cargo.
Prepping Your E-Bike for Safe Transit: A Step-by-Step Breakdown
Proper preparation is key to preventing damage during transit. Think of this as getting your e-bike ready for a long, bumpy journey. Every component needs consideration.
Cleaning and Inspection
Before anything else, give your e-bike a thorough clean. Dirt and grime can scratch paint or get into moving parts during shipping. This is also a great opportunity to inspect for any existing damage.
Take detailed photos of your e-bike from all angles, especially noting any pre-existing scratches or dents. These photos will be invaluable if you need to file an insurance claim later.
Battery Removal and Protection
This is the most critical step. Always remove the battery from your electric bike before packing the bike itself. Never ship an e-bike with the battery installed and connected.
Once removed, protect the battery terminals with non-conductive tape (electrical tape works well) to prevent short circuits. Place the battery in a separate, sturdy box, ideally its original packaging if available, or a well-padded box. Ensure it’s clearly labeled according to carrier hazardous material guidelines.
Removing Loose Components
To minimize damage, remove anything that can easily come loose or break off. This typically includes:
- Pedals (use a pedal wrench)
- Front wheel (most e-bikes have quick-release or thru-axle front wheels)
- Handlebars (loosen the stem bolts and rotate or remove them)
- Seatpost and saddle
- Fenders, racks, and any accessories (lights, mirrors, bike computer)
Keep all removed bolts, washers, and small parts together in a clearly labeled plastic bag. Taping this bag to the frame or handlebars can prevent it from getting lost.
Protecting Delicate Parts
Use foam padding, bubble wrap, or pipe insulation to protect sensitive areas. Focus on:
- Derailleur and rear wheel axle
- Brake levers and shifters
- Fork dropouts (use plastic fork spacers if available, or make some from cardboard)
- Disc brake rotors (remove them if possible, or pad them extremely well)
- Exposed frame tubes
Secure padding with packing tape, but avoid taping directly onto painted surfaces where possible, as it can pull off paint.
Packing Your Electric Bike Like a Pro: Materials and Techniques
A well-packed e-bike is a safe e-bike. Investing in good packing materials and taking your time here will pay dividends.
Choosing the Right Box
A dedicated bike box is your best bet. Bike shops often have these available, sometimes for free or a small fee. They are designed to fit a disassembled bike and are made from thick, corrugated cardboard.
If you can’t find a bike box, you can create one by combining several large moving boxes. Just make sure the combined box is sturdy enough and securely taped together. The dimensions should be large enough to accommodate the main frame and rear wheel without excessive force.
Disassembly for Packing
Depending on your box size and the bike’s design, you’ll need to disassemble further.
- Front Wheel: If removed, secure it alongside the frame, using zip ties or tape. Place a cardboard disc on each side of the wheel to protect the spokes and rotor.
- Handlebars: Either rotate them parallel to the frame or remove them completely from the stem. If removed, tape them to the top tube. Protect grips and levers with bubble wrap.
- Fork: If the front wheel is removed, secure the fork to the frame. Install a fork spacer (a plastic block that goes between the dropouts) to prevent the fork from being crushed.
- Pedals: Always remove these. Note that one pedal is reverse-threaded. Keep them with your small parts bag.
- Seatpost/Saddle: Remove and wrap separately.
Internal Padding and Securing
Once the bike is inside the box, it shouldn’t be able to move freely. Use plenty of additional padding.
- Crumpled newspaper, foam peanuts, or air pillows can fill empty spaces.
- Zip ties or heavy-duty packing tape can secure the frame and components to prevent shifting.
- Ensure no metal parts are directly touching each other or the inside of the box without padding.
Sealing and Labeling
Seal the box thoroughly with high-quality packing tape. Apply multiple layers across all seams and edges.
Attach your shipping label securely, making sure it’s clearly visible. If you’re shipping the battery separately, ensure that package is also correctly labeled with the appropriate hazardous material warnings. Write “Fragile” and “This Side Up” on the box, though remember carriers don’t always honor these requests, so pack as if it will be handled roughly.
Cost-Saving Tips and Insurance for Shipping Your E-Bike
Shipping an electric bike can be an investment, but there are ways to manage the costs and protect yourself.
Comparing Shipping Quotes
Don’t settle for the first quote. Get prices from multiple carriers and specialty bike shippers. Provide accurate dimensions and weight for the packed box, as even small discrepancies can significantly alter the cost.
Consider shipping during off-peak times if your schedule allows, as some carriers may offer better rates. Ground shipping is almost always cheaper than air freight, but slower.
DIY vs. Professional Packing
Packing it yourself can save money on labor, but only if you do it correctly. A poorly packed bike is more likely to be damaged, leading to potentially higher costs in repairs or replacement.
If you’re not confident in your packing skills, consider having a local bike shop professionally pack it for a fee. This often includes a sturdy bike box and the peace of mind that it’s done right.
Insurance: A Non-Negotiable
Given the value of electric bikes, shipping insurance is highly recommended, if not essential. Standard carrier liability is often very limited and won’t cover the full replacement cost of an expensive e-bike.
Purchase additional insurance for the full declared value of your bike. Read the policy carefully to understand what is covered and what documentation you’ll need if you have to file a claim. Remember those photos you took earlier? They’re crucial here.

Tracking Your E-Bike Shipment and What to Do Upon Arrival
The shipping process isn’t over until your e-bike is safely in its new home and inspected. Stay vigilant!
Monitoring Your Shipment
Use the tracking number provided by the carrier to monitor your e-bike’s progress. Be aware of any unexpected delays or reroutes. If you notice a significant hold-up, contact the carrier immediately.
Receiving and Inspecting Your E-Bike
When your electric bike arrives, resist the urge to immediately tear into the box. This is another crucial inspection point.
- Inspect the Box: Before opening, carefully check the exterior of the box for any signs of damage – dents, punctures, tears, or crushed corners. Take photos of any damage to the box itself.
- Unpack Carefully: Open the box and carefully remove all padding and components. Keep all packing materials until you’ve fully inspected the bike.
- Thorough Inspection: Inspect the e-bike itself for any new scratches, dents, bent components, or other damage that wasn’t present when you shipped it. Pay close attention to the frame, wheels, fork, drivetrain, and electronics.
- Document Everything: Take photos of any damage found during unpacking and inspection. These photos, combined with your pre-shipment photos and the box inspection photos, will be vital for any insurance claims.
- Assemble and Test: Reassemble your e-bike and, once fully assembled, perform a quick function test. Check the brakes, gears, and especially the electrical system (after carefully re-installing the battery).
If you find damage, file a claim with the shipping carrier and your insurance provider as soon as possible, following their specific procedures. Time limits for claims are often very strict.
Frequently Asked Questions About How to Ship Electric Bike
Shipping an e-bike can bring up a lot of questions. Here are some of the most common ones we hear.
Can I ship an electric bike with the battery still attached?
No, almost all carriers require the lithium-ion battery to be removed and shipped separately as a hazardous material, or they have strict guidelines for shipping it with the bike (e.g., disconnected, under a certain Wh limit, in specific packaging). Always check with your chosen carrier first, but plan on removing it.
How much does it typically cost to ship an electric bike?
The cost varies widely based on size, weight, distance, chosen carrier, and speed of service. Generally, you can expect to pay anywhere from $100 to $300+ for ground shipping within the continental US, and significantly more for international or expedited services, especially if special hazardous material handling for the battery is required.
Do I need a special box to ship an e-bike?
While you can make a box work by combining several large cardboard boxes, a dedicated bike shipping box is highly recommended. These boxes are designed to fit a disassembled bicycle and offer better protection and structural integrity, reducing the risk of damage during transit.
What if my e-bike gets damaged during shipping?
If your e-bike arrives damaged, immediately document everything with photos (the box, the damage itself). Do not discard any packing materials. Contact the shipping carrier and your insurance provider (if you purchased additional insurance) as soon as possible to file a claim. Be prepared to provide all documentation, including your pre-shipment photos.
Can I ship my e-bike internationally?
Yes, but it’s significantly more complex. International shipping involves customs declarations, potential import duties, and even stricter regulations for lithium-ion batteries. You will likely need to use a freight forwarder or a specialized international bike shipper. Be prepared for higher costs and longer transit times.
